Abstract

[ 131 I]Albumin and [ 125 I]-γ-globulin were used to mark the bulk flow of aqueous humour in young vervet monkeys. In living animals, at a mean intraocular pressure of about 13 mmHg, the not formation of aqueous humour was 0·96 ± 0·11 μl/min. The mean rate of outflow by conventional routes was 0·74 ± 0·12 μl/min and that by way of uveo-scleral routes was 0·23 ± 0·04 μl/min. After death, at an intraocular pressure artificially maintained at 14 mmHg, the rate of uveo-scleral flow was 1·13 ± 0·13 μl/min.
